Ok, my story is very long and I won't go into all the details or this will be too long. I was banded July 1, 2003. That October I moved to Pennsylvania. I had major complications after surgery and my original Dr. thought I had a hole because I could not get the proper restriction. The did x-ray's but could not see a hole. I moved bac to PA like I said and started seeing a Dr. here. Who discovered I did in fact have a hole but that it was a slow leak and that is why they could not see it before. My Dr. believes the hole was there from day #1. My husband and I were going to try to get pregnant so I told him I would hold off for awhile. Well, now my question is does my surgeon who put in my band have any responsibility to fix this? Do you think I need to talk to an attorney? Please give me any advise you may have. Robin, I agree that contacting the manufacturer of your band is the first thing you should do. Who if anyone bears responsibility for that hole is a matter to be determined: was the band defective from the start? Or did the surgeon do something to damage it during surgery?

Well, now my question is does my surgeon who put in my band have any responsibility to fix this?

Yes!

My hole was in the tubing. Dr. Sanchez replaced my band after an atempt to fix the tubing, but that didn't work. The manufacture of the band had to pay for the replacement and surgery costs.

How could your doctor prove that the hole was caused by the surgeon?
